NACHI Vane Pump VDR-1B-1A1-U-1586K — Technical Product Introduction

The NACHI VDR-1B-1A1-U-1586K is a precision-engineered variable displacement vane pump designed to deliver efficient hydraulic power with stable pressure control, quiet operation, and long service life. As part of NACHI’s renowned VDR Series, this model incorporates advanced variable-flow technology, offering excellent energy efficiency and consistent performance across a wide range of industrial applications.

Built with NACHI’s long-standing expertise in hydraulic systems, the VDR-1B-1A1-U-1586K provides superior control for modern machinery that demands precision, durability, and energy-conscious performance. It is particularly suitable for applications in machine tools, plastic injection molding, presses, and industrial automation systems.


1. Product Overview

The VDR-1B-1A1-U-1586K belongs to NACHI’s VDR (Variable Displacement Regulated) series, which is known for integrating pressure-compensated control mechanisms. This design allows the pump to automatically adjust its output flow to maintain a constant system pressure, reducing unnecessary energy loss and heat buildup.

This model is compact, lightweight, and designed for high reliability under continuous-duty operation. It features a balanced rotor, low-noise vane system, and optimized pressure compensator, ensuring smooth hydraulic performance and high volumetric efficiency.


2. Key Specifications

Parameter Specification
Model VDR-1B-1A1-U-1586K
Series VDR Series (Variable Displacement Vane Pump)
Pump Type Pressure-compensated, variable displacement
Mounting Type Flange-mounted, horizontal
Rotation Direction Clockwise (viewed from shaft end)
Displacement Range 8 – 25 cm³/rev (variable)
Rated Pressure 12 MPa (1740 psi)
Maximum Pressure 14 MPa (2030 psi)
Rated Speed 1800 rpm
Permissible Speed Range 600 – 1800 rpm
Flow Rate at 1800 rpm 20 – 25 L/min (variable)
Suction Pressure 0.03 MPa abs (minimum)
Fluid Type Mineral-based hydraulic oil (ISO VG32–68)
Viscosity Range 20 – 400 mm²/s (cSt)
Operating Temperature 0 °C – +60 °C
Control Type Pressure-compensated with automatic displacement regulation
Shaft Type Straight keyed shaft
Noise Level Below 60 dB(A) at rated pressure
Weight Approx. 9.5 kg

7. Installation and Operation Guidelines

To ensure optimal performance of the VDR-1B-1A1-U-1586K, the following operating guidelines are recommended:

Parameter Recommendation
Mounting Position Horizontal installation preferred; ensure shaft alignment
Fluid Type Use clean mineral hydraulic oil (ISO VG32–68)
Filtration Level Use a filter rated at 10 µm absolute or finer
Oil Temperature Maintain between 30 °C – 50 °C for optimal performance
Suction Line Keep as short as possible; use a large-diameter hose to reduce suction loss
Pressure Adjustment Use a precision pressure gauge when setting relief values; never exceed 14 MPa
Start-Up Procedure Prime the pump fully to remove air before first operation
Maintenance Schedule Inspect seals, bearings, and vanes every 4000–6000 hours or as required by service conditions

Proper installation and maintenance ensure stable performance, minimal noise, and long service life.

9. Advantages Compared to Conventional Fixed-Displacement Pumps

Aspect VDR-1B-1A1-U-1586K (Variable) Fixed-Displacement Pump
Energy Consumption Adjusts automatically to load; highly efficient Constant energy use regardless of demand
Pressure Stability Maintains constant pressure automatically Requires external control valves
Noise Level Low, under 60 dB(A) Generally higher
Maintenance Modular and easy More complex system design
System Heat Generation Minimal due to reduced energy waste Higher due to continuous full-flow operation

This comparison shows how the NACHI VDR Series, particularly the VDR-1B-1A1-U-1586K, provides superior efficiency and cost-effectiveness in modern hydraulic systems.
